Output 11b51b33aac76285b975eec01c249646f43663bd70eec5de44618f4e6a69e0bb:0

value
32239094
script pubkey
OP_0 OP_PUSHBYTES_20 7ecf1910be5fa923d693f535e0d16a38b02a04c9
address
bc1q0m83jy97t75j845n7567p5t28zcz5pxfta76rt
transaction
11b51b33aac76285b975eec01c249646f43663bd70eec5de44618f4e6a69e0bb
confirmations
138022
spent
true